MCM

An abbreviation for "man crush Monday," a hashtag that accompanies a social media post of a man that the poster finds attractive (often a significant other or a celebrity). Such posts occur on Mondays due to the name, created simply for alliteration. Check out my handsome hubby! #MCM Ryan Gosling is my #mcm.
